Research Associate, Adaptation

Canadian Climate Institute

Location: Work From Home - Alberta, British Columbia, Ontario, Quebec, Saskatchewan, Manitoba, and other regions in Canada

Application Deadline: Closes in 6 days (Sun, 4 May). Open until filled. Interviews will be conducted on a rolling basis, so early application is encouraged.

Salary Range: $60,000–$80,000 depending on qualifications and experience

The Role

Reporting to the Research Director, the Research Associate will support the Adaptation team in identifying and executing research projects to improve climate change adaptation policy in Canada. Responsibilities include conducting literature reviews, data synthesis and analysis, writing for publications, collaborating with various research teams, developing communication strategies, and stakeholder engagement.

The team focuses on proactive adaptation policies to enhance Canada's resilience against climate impacts, involving governance and policy innovation across multiple sectors.

Preferred Qualifications and Experience

  • Master’s Degree in Public Policy, Economics, Social Sciences, Environmental or Climate Change Studies, Resource Management, or related fields with relevant policy research experience.
  • Experience with quantitative research, climate impact modeling, and data interpretation.
  • Strong research, writing, and project management skills.
  • At least 2 years of policy research experience, including literature review and data analysis.
  • Interest in climate change, energy, and resource policy.
  • Bilingual in French and English is a strong asset.
  • Self-directed, independent, and collaborative work skills.

What We Offer

  • Full-time (40 hrs/week) salaried position with occasional travel.
  • Meaningful work with a national, dedicated team.
  • Flexible, virtual work environment with home-office support.
  • Paid vacation, holidays, and additional days off.
  • Benefits including health care, employee assistance, paid sick and parental leave, and more.
  • Opportunity for professional development and conference participation.

The Canadian Climate Institute values diversity and is committed to justice and equity. We encourage applications from Indigenous peoples, minorities, women, LGBTQIA2S+, and persons with disabilities, considering relevant life experience alongside qualifications.
